About Junyang Yue
Junyang Yue is a scholar working on Molecular Biology, Plant Science, Food Science, Cell Biology and Biochemistry, having authored 41 papers that have together received 1.3k indexed citations. Recurring topics across this work include Plant Gene Expression Analysis (11 papers), Plant Molecular Biology Research (7 papers), Plant biochemistry and biosynthesis (6 papers), Plant Physiology and Cultivation Studies (5 papers), Genomics and Phylogenetic Studies (5 papers), Chromosomal and Genetic Variations (4 papers), Fermentation and Sensory Analysis (3 papers) and Phytochemicals and Antioxidant Activities (3 papers). The work is most often cited by research in Biochemistry (132 citations), Plant Science (669 citations), Molecular Biology (720 citations), Food Science (170 citations) and Horticulture (8 citations). Junyang Yue has collaborated with scholars based in China, United States and Malaysia. Frequent co-authors include Yongsheng Liu, Zhangjun Fei, Xiangli Niu, Min Miao, Ying Yang, Congbing Fang, Xiaofeng Tang, Lihuan Wang, Zeyu Wu and Yongkang Ye. Their work appears in journals such as Horticulture Research, The Plant Journal, Database, Frontiers in Plant Science and Frontiers in Microbiology.
